#787457 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#787457 is composed of 47.1% red, 45.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 52.7 degrees, a saturation of 15.9% and a lightness of 40.6%. #787457 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0e8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#787457 color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.

#787457 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#787457 has RGB values of R:120, G:116,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.28,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7894103.

Shades and Tints of #787457

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060605 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#787457

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686867 is the less saturated color, while #c8b007 is the most saturated one.
